LEGO Macintosh and 80s workdesk
Computers and the internet are without a doubt Wonders of the modern world, so Ryan decided to represent them by building a classic 1984 Macintosh computer, complete with 80s workdesk, including a Rubik's Cube (solved of course!), a rolodex and clunky calculator all also built from LEGO! Designed and built by Ryan McNaught and Clay Mellington, the Mac took 22 hours and 4,500 bricks to create.
